Exploring Pakistani Rupee to United States Dollar Conversion

For those planning a journey to the United States, the need to exchange Pakistani rupees for U.S. dollars arises. The U.S. dollar, denoted by the symbol $, serves as the nation’s official currency. In the global arena, it holds a prominent status, with over 40% of international payments conducted in this currency, making it the most widely used in international trade. U.S. paper currency is available in various denominations including $1, $2, $5, $10, $20, $50, and $100. Despite discontinuing larger bills like $500, $1,000, $5,000, and $10,000, they may still circulate and are recognized as legal tender.

Besides the United States,

numerous countries including Aruba, Barbados, Ecuador, and Panama, to name a few, accept the U.S. dollar as an official currency.

How to Convert Pakistani Rupee to U.S. Dollars

Thankfully, converting Pakistani rupees to U.S. dollars is straightforward. You can opt for a currency calculator or perform the calculation manually.

  1. Utilize a Currency Calculator:

  2. A currency conversion calculator offers a convenient means to estimate currency conversion. Given the daily fluctuations in exchange rates, relying on a calculator ensures accuracy in your conversions. However, bear in mind that currency exchange often involves additional fees, such as the 1% conversion fee commonly charged by credit card companies and ATM networks for foreign transactions. Additionally, individual merchants may levy fees for currency conversion during checkout.
  3. Manual Calculation:

  4. Alternatively, you can manually calculate conversions using a simple mathematical formula. This method requires knowledge of the current exchange rate. As of the time of writing, 1 PKR equals 0.004 USD. To calculate, multiply your PKR amount by the prevailing exchange rate. For example, 100 PKR multiplied by 0.004 equals 4 USD.

How to Acquire USD

When it comes to purchasing USD, strategic planning can help minimize associated fees. Here are three methods to secure the currency while minimizing costs:

Visit Your Bank’s Website:

Most banks in Pakistan provide an online foreign exchange portal for currency exchange requests.

Open a Foreign Currency Savings Account:

Consider opening a foreign currency savings account, particularly if you frequently travel to the United States. This option provides convenience and potential savings on exchange fees.

Utilize In-Network ATMs Abroad:

While traveling, aim to use ATMs affiliated with your bank to avoid excess fees. Most banking apps offer an ATM locator feature for added convenience.

Order Currency Online:

Some third-party vendors offer currency delivery services. However, be mindful of associated costs. For instance, while Currency Exchange International (CXI) doesn’t charge exchange fees, they may levy shipping fees, which can amount to up to $30 for overnight delivery.

It’s important to note that taking foreign currencies out of Pakistan is subject to limitations, with a cap of 10,000 USD. Furthermore, the State Bank of Pakistan mandates biometric verification for purchases exceeding 500 USD on the open market. Additionally, Pakistan’s central bank imposes restrictions on foreign currency purchases through exchange companies, limiting transactions to 10,000 USD per day and 100,000 USD per calendar year.
